The Gong Show was great. Gene Gene was a rug-cutter allright. Remember the Unknown Comic who came out with a paperbag over his head. Onetime he came out with a little dummy to do a ventriloquist act and the dummy had a little paperbag over his head.
And Chuck Barris always wore hats to hide behind. Remember Jaye P. Morgan was always saying something dirty and getting bleeped. What a show.
